If two lines are perpendicular to each other, they have opposite slopes.
The first line is y = -2x + 8. Its slope is -2. A line perpendicular to this one will have a slope of 1/2.
Plug this value (1/2) into your standard point-slope equation of y = mx + b.
y = 1/2x + b
To find b, we want to plug in a value that we know is on this line: in this case, it is (4, -2). Plug in the x and y values into the x and y of the standard equation.
-2 = 1/2(4) + b
To find b, multiply the slope and the input of x (4)
-2 = 2 + b
Now, subtract 2 from both sides to isolate b.
-4 = b
Plug this into your standard equation.
y = 1/2x - 4
This equation is perpendicular to your given equation (y = -2x + 8) and contains point (4, -2)

Step-by-step explanation:
2x + 3y = 11 ------------(i)
-4x + 2y = 2 ------------(ii)
Multiply equation (i) by 2.
(i)*2 4x + 6y = 22
(ii) <u>-4x + 2y = 2</u> {Now add and x will be eliminated}
8y = 24
y= 24/8
y = 3
Plugin the value of y in equation (i)
2x + 3*3 = 11
2x + 9 = 11
2x = 11-9
2x = 2
x = 2/2
x = 1
